Psychological Test
A systematic procedure that obtains samples of behavior relevant to cognitive or affective functioning, scored and evaluated according to standards.
Standardized Test
A test with uniformity of procedure and use of standards for evaluating test results.
Ability Test
Samples knowledge, skills, and cognitive functions.
Personality Test
Samples relatively stable characteristics.
Scale
A group of items that pertain to a single variable and are arranged in order of difficulty or intensity.
Thurstone Scaling
A technique for developing an interval scale where subsequent item values are at equal distances.
Likert Scaling
Items are answered on a range (e.g., 5-point scale) with typical responses like strongly disagree, disagree, neutral, agree, strongly agree.
Guttman Scaling
Each scale item has a scale value associated with it. A respondent's scale score is computed by summing the scale values of every item they agree with.
